Scotchguard For Clothes

I worked with a young teacher who wore Kahki pants a lot and they always seemed so spot free and clean. One day I got the courage to ask her secret. She said that when she bought new clothes she sprayed them with scotchguard before wearing or washing them . She would occasionally refresh the scotchguard after washing. I do this with my daughter's clothes all the time. She's very prone to getting chocolate and tomato sauce on her expensive clothes. Just remember not to use fabric softener; it reduces the effectiveness of Scotchguard.
